TP官方网址下载-tpwallet下载/最新版本/安卓版安装-tp官方下载安卓最新版本2024
【本文说明】
你提到“tp里面eos怎么创建”,由于不同产品/平台对“TP”的含义可能不同(例如:某些交易/托管平台、某些链浏览器/开发平台、或某类业务系统简称TP),而“eos”也可能指 EOS 区块链、EOSIO 智能合约体系,或某种“资产/代币/账户”的简称。为保证可读性与可执行性,本文以最常见的工程语境来展开:
1)在 EOSIO(即 EOS 主网/测试网)上创建合约账户(contract account);
2)在 TP 系统中通过合约调用触发链上逻辑;
3)结合“安全支付平台、智能算法服务、跨链钱包、专业判断”的业务架构做端到端落地分析;
4)“恒星币”部分给出可选的跨链/结算/风控联动方案(文中以“恒星币 XLM 作为跨链资产”的方式讨论)。
——
一、TP 里“创建 EOS”的两种典型理解与选择
1)链上创建:在 EOSIO 上创建合约账户(最标准、最工程化)
你真正“创建”的通常不是“EOS 本身”,而是:
- 创建 EOSIO 账户(如:tokenissuer、paycontract、marketmaker 等);
- 部署智能合约到该账户;
- 设置权限(active/owner/加密公钥或多签);
- 之后由其他合约或前端/服务端通过“合约调用”来执行业务。
2)业务侧创建:在 TP 中创建“EOS 资产/通道/托管/映射”
有些 TP 平台会把 EOS 资产(或 EOS 相关链上地址)封装为“资产通道/托管账户/资金池”。这时“创建”更像配置:
- 绑定 EOS 地址/合约账户;
- 配置充值/提现路由;
- 配置对账与风控阈值;
- 配置签名与授权(热钱包/冷钱包、多签)。
【建议】
如果你的目标是“做出可运行的 EOSIO 智能合约与合约调用”,优先按第一种理解(链上创建合约账户 + 部署合约)。如果你的目标是“把 EOS 资产接入安全支付平台并完成跨链结算”,则在第一种基础上,追加业务侧的资金路由与合规控制。
——
二、EOSIO 智能合约账户创建:步骤详解(链上标准流程)
以下步骤假设你已经具备:EOSIO 节点/测试网环境、可用的账户创建权限(creator)、以及部署所需的密钥管理体系。
Step 0:准备环境与工具
- 确认网络:mainnet 或 testnet;
- 准备账号创建权限(通常由系统管理员账号拥有 authority);
- 工具链:
- cleos(命令行)或你使用的 EOS SDK/客户端;
- 合约编译工具链(C++ + EOSIO 工具链);
- ABI/合约包与表结构设计。
Step 1:创建合约账户(account creation)
你需要一笔资源:
- 使用 authority 账户(例如:eosio 或你的主控账号)创建新账户;
- 指定 new account 名称(例如:myeospay1);
- 指定公钥(owner_public_key、active_public_key)。
概念上你会做:
- “创建账户”指令:写入链上账户与权限。
- 随后才是“部署合约”。
Step 2:为合约账户配置权限与多签/限权(安全关键)
建议:
- active 用于合约执行/转账/授权;
- owner 少用且严格保护;
- 使用多签:将合约管理权限拆分(例如:部署者、审计者、资金管理员三方);
- 最小权限原则:合约账户只保留必要的权限。
Step 3:部署合约(deploy)
- 编译得到 wasm;
- 生成 ABI(若需要);
- 调用“set code / set abi”把 wasm 与 abi 部署到合约账户;
- 检查合约是否成功写入。
Step 4:通过“合约初始化/初始化表”完成业务就绪
很多合约需要初始化:
- 设置管理员;
- 设置费率、费池、白名单;
- 设置 token 合约地址/外部依赖;
- 创建数据库表(或在第一次写入时自动创建)。
Step 5:测试合约调用(dispatcher/ABI 调用)
- 使用 cleos 调用 action(或由你的 TP 后端调用);
- 验证:权限是否正确;
- 验证:表数据是否符合预期;
- 验证:错误处理路径(如资金不足、签名无效、参数非法)。
——
三、TP 场景下“合约调用”的落地方式(后端/中台/前端协同)
你提出“合约调用”,通常意味着:TP 平台需要触发链上交易并同步状态。
1)调用链路建议(分层)
- 前端:发起业务请求(例如:支付/下单/铸造/兑换)。
- TP 后端:
- 参数校验(专业判断:风控规则、合规判断、反欺诈);
- 选择路由(链上/离线/跨链);
- 调用签名服务生成签名;
- 提交链上 action。
- 链上合约:执行核心逻辑(状态变更、事件记录)。
- TP 索引器:监听区块/回执,更新订单状态。
2)关键点:签名与私钥管理
安全建议:
- 不要把私钥放在前端;

- 使用独立签名服务(HSM/安全模块、或至少 KMS + 访问控制 + 审计日志);
- 对关键方法启用“二次确认/多签门槛”。
3)重放保护与幂等设计
合约侧:
- 用 nonce、order_id、request_id 做幂等;
- 确保同一请求不会重复扣款/重复铸币。
TP 侧:
- 保存 tx_id 与业务状态机;
- 处理链上延迟与回滚(如果遇到 reorg 或网络异常)。
——
四、安全支付平台:把 EOS 支付做成“可控、可审计、可回滚”的系统
你希望“安全支付平台”,可以把它拆为五个模块:
1)资金接入与托管策略
- 热钱包:处理小额高频;
- 冷钱包:处理大额与日终对账;
- 多签/阈值:限制单点风险。
2)支付路由(Payment Routing)
- 识别用户资产(例如 EOS、或跨链资产);
- 决定“走链上原生支付”还是“走跨链支付”;
- 决定交易费支付方式(EOS 资源/手续费策略)。
3)风控与专业判断(Professional Judgement)
- 地址信誉:黑名单/灰名单;
- 交易模式:频率、金额分布、规律性;
- 设备指纹/账号风险:KYC/AML(按业务场景合规);
- 触发规则:超过阈值要求额外验证或延迟放行。
4)对账与回执
- 订单状态机:待支付/确认中/完成/失败/部分完成;
- 事件溯源:用合约事件/表变化证明;
- 争议处理:失败重试与人工审核流。
5)灾备与应急
- 链路中断:排队与降级;
- 合约升级:采用版本化/可回滚;
- 资金转移:审批流与审计。
——
五、智能算法服务:让支付与跨链“更会判断、更会定价、更会预警”
你提出“智能算法服务”,建议把算法落在“决策层”而非直接把所有逻辑写进链上合约(链上成本高且升级困难)。
可用的算法方向:
1)风险评分模型
- 输入:地址行为、历史成功率、滑点/撤单、跨链失败原因;
- 输出:risk_score(0-100)与处置策略(放行/限额/二次验证/冻结)。
2)动态费率与流动性策略
- 根据链上拥堵、资源价格、路由成功率调整报价;
- 对“跨链兑换/结算”选择最优路径。

3)交易失败预测与自动重试
- 识别失败类型:签名失败、资源不足、nonce 冲突、合约条件不满足;
- 给出重试建议:改用替代 gas/资源策略,或提示用户。
4)反洗钱/异常检测
- 聚类检测:相似交易网络;
- 模式匹配:典型“分散搬砖/撞库/高频小额”行为。
——
六、跨链钱包:把 EOS 与“恒星币(XLM)等资产”打通的策略
你同时提到“跨链钱包”和“恒星币”。这里给出一个通用思路:
- 跨链钱包不是简单“转账工具”,而是:资产映射 + 风险控制 + 兑换/结算路径 + 状态同步。
1)核心组件
- 钱包托管/签名:多链统一密钥策略;
- 地址映射:EOS 账户与跨链资产地址的映射关系;
- 路由器:决定跨链通道(例如:通过中继/桥接服务或采用原生支持的互操作机制);
- 状态同步器:确认跨链消息被接收并可领取。
2)恒星币(XLM)与 EOS 的可能业务场景
- 结算资产:用户用 XLM 支付,平台用 EOS 完成链上业务(或反之)。
- 跨链汇兑:在链外或桥接层完成兑换,再将 EOS 路由到业务合约。
- 风险隔离:把高波动资产(如某些跨链资产)分配不同限额。
3)安全要点
- 证明与审计:必须记录跨链消息 ID、来源链 tx、目标链回执;
- 防止双花:跨链领取与锁定状态必须可验证;
- 最小信任:优先使用可信中继/多方签名桥接,并设定延迟提款策略。
——
七、专业判断如何嵌入“合约调用 + 支付 + 跨链”
把“专业判断”落成规则与流程(而不是凭空判断):
- 规则引擎:
- 交易阈值、地址风险、地区风险、设备风险;
- 动态风控:当风险升高时自动降低额度或要求二次验证。
- 审计系统:
- 每次决策保存输入特征、命中规则、输出策略;
- 人工复核通道:
- 对高额/高风险订单走人工审批。
合约侧也应配合:
- 合约要求外部“授权/许可证明”(例如平台签发的 off-chain 许可,或 on-chain 白名单);
- 即使后端判断失误,合约也能阻断明显违规请求。
——
八、智能化商业模式:把技术系统变成可持续收入
你提到“智能化商业模式”,可用“平台化 + 数据化 + 风控化 + 迭代化”的方式设计:
1)平台能力收费
- 支付通道费:按笔或按比例;
- 跨链服务费:按路线与失败率定价;
- 安全托管服务费:对企业客户按月/按量收取。
2)智能算法服务收费
- 风险评分 API:按调用量收费;
- 动态费率/路由优化:按交易规模或节省成本分成;
- 报表与审计:企业合规报表订阅。
3)开发者生态与合约服务
- 提供模板合约(支付、代币发行、托管、分账);
- 提供安全审计与升级服务;
- 收取部署/维护费用。
4)专业判断带来的“增值服务”
- 为商户提供“更低失败率、更快清算、更少争议”的 SLA;
- 对高风险行业提供增强版风控。
5)可扩展性
- 从 EOS 扩展到更多链:保持统一的跨链钱包与风控框架;
- 算法模型迭代:吸收更多链的数据,提高成功率。
——
九、综合分析:这个架构如何闭环(从“创建 EOS”到“商业变现”)
1)技术闭环
- EOSIO 侧:合约账户创建 → 部署 → 合约调用 → 事件/状态可追溯;
- TP 侧:支付路由 → 签名服务 → 风控决策 → 状态同步。
2)安全闭环
- 钱包签名安全(KMS/HSM、多签);
- 合约幂等与权限最小化;
- 跨链消息可审计、可回执。
3)商业闭环
- 通过安全支付平台承接交易量;
- 通过智能算法服务提升转化率、降低失败率从而降本增效;
- 通过跨链钱包扩大可服务资产范围(包括恒星币等),提升覆盖面与订单密度。
——
十、你下一步需要补充的关键信息(我才能给“精确到操作”的版本)
请你回答 4 个问题,我就能把“TP 里 EOS 怎么创建”写成你平台可直接复制的操作清单:
1)你说的“TP”具体是哪个产品/系统?(名称/链接/截图或官网描述)
2)你要创建的是:EOSIO 账户、EOS 智能合约、还是某个“资产/代币/映射通道”?
3)你用的是 EOS 主网还是测试网?(是否有账户创建权限)
4)跨链是否要求恒星币(XLM)参与?还是只是提到业务方向。
如你补充以上信息,我可以把本文升级为:
- 具体指令/参数级步骤(如账户名、权限设置、set code/abi 调用要点);
- TP 后端签名与回执落库字段设计;
- 支付订单状态机与幂等键设计;
- 跨链钱包的消息 ID 追踪与失败重试策略。
评论